

Punggol and Sengkang, located in northeastern Singapore, are next‑generation residential new towns that have been a key focus of urban planning and development over the past two decades. Known for their modern master planning, family‑friendly environment, and relatively affordable housing, these districts have become popular choices for first‑time homebuyers and young families.
With the ongoing development of the Punggol Digital District, the area is steadily evolving from what was once considered a peripheral new town into an emerging integrated lifestyle hub that combines residential living, education, technology, and employment opportunities.

🚇 Transportation
• Punggol MRT and Sengkang MRT on the North East Line (NEL)
• Light Rail Transit (LRT) system providing extensive intra‑town connectivity
• Approximately 35–45 minutes of commuting time to the Central Business District (CBD)
• The upcoming Punggol Digital District is expected to further enhance regional connectivity and reshape local employment opportunities

Property Mix
• A large supply of new HDB flats
• Multiple relatively new Executive Condominium (EC) projects in Punggol, while Sengkang currently has no EC developments
• A limited but gradually increasing number of private condominium projects
Housing Prices and Rental Rates (2025 reference)
• Average price of private condominiums:
o S$1,500 - 2,750 per square foot
• Indicative private rental rates:
o One-bedroom: S$2,500 - 5,000 per month
o Two-bedroom: S$3,000 - 5,900 per month
o Three-bedroom: S$4,000 - 7,600 per month

Punggol and Sengkang continue to benefit from long‑term urban planning initiatives, with development momentum concentrated around employment creation and infrastructure upgrades.
• The Punggol Digital District (PDD) is expected to bring substantial technology‑ and education‑related employment opportunities
• While land reserves in these new towns remain ample, the supply of private residential developments is still limited
• Rental demand is gradually strengthening, driven by job growth and improved connectivity
• The area offers positive long‑term prospects, but is better suited for medium‑ to long‑term hold investors rather than short‑term speculation
